Who might be able to join this trial:
- People who are right-handed
- People who speak English as their only language
- People who have had a single stroke affecting the left side of the brain
- People who are at least six months past their stroke
- People who have been clinically diagnosed with apraxia of speech (a motor speech disorder caused by brain damage)
- People who have normal speech perception (the ability to hear and understand speech sounds)
- People who pass a hearing screening test
Who may not be able to join:
- People who have a diagnosed voice disorder affecting the voice box (larynx)
- People who have dysarthria (a muscle-related speech disorder)
- People who had a speech impairment before their stroke
- People who have damaged skin at the area of the body where the brain stimulation device would be placed
- People who have an implanted device that runs on electricity or magnetism, such as a pacemaker
- People who have any metal anywhere in their body
- People who have a family history of epilepsy that does not respond to medication
- People who have a personal history of seizures or unexplained episodes of loss of consciousness
